Ultraviolette Automotive has announced a major milestone for India’s performance electric motorcycle segment. An F77 owner has successfully completed 100,000 km of real-world riding within 17 months, demonstrating the bike’s durability, reliability, and long-term performance. Even more impressive, the motorcycle’s battery health remains at 96%, setting a new industry benchmark.
This achievement reinforces the F77’s positioning as one of India’s most advanced electric motorcycles, designed for endurance, efficiency, and sustained performance across varied riding conditions.
Battery Shows Only 4% Degradation After Extensive Usage
The F77’s 10.3 kWh battery pack—engineered with aviation-grade standards—exhibited minimal degradation despite the long-distance, daily usage pattern. Ultraviolette confirmed that extensive diagnostics revealed consistent battery performance, stable temperature management, and strong efficiency levels.
Such low degradation over high mileage is crucial for building rider confidence in long-term EV ownership and counters typical concerns around battery deterioration.
